I will try with 2.6.8.1 as soon as i can, meanwhile, i have discovered that 
the problem is resolved if i add the "tcp" option to the mount line.

I am downloading 2.6.8.1 right now...

The strace of gunzip is located at the following URL (it is about 100kb i am 
not attaching it at the mail):

"http://www.gardiol.org/strace.gzip";

I did many tests with different zipped files, this is the only case it fails.

> 2.6.8 had some bug in nfs, please use 2.6.8.1 or 2.6.9-rc1, and test it
> over again, without tainting the kernel (you at least have nvidia module
> in there).
